body {
	margin:auto;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#000000;
	font-size: 11px;
	background-color: #FFFFFF;
	text-decoration: none;
	background-image: url(../images/body.gif);
}
.style1 {
	color: #EE0000;
}

.header-menu { text-align: center; font-size:11; color: #FFFF00; padding-top:3px; padding-bottom:3px; font-variant: small-caps; text-transform: 
               uppercase; font-weight: bold; background-image: url(../images/menutopnen.png)   ; 
               background-repeat: repeat-x; background-position: left center }
.header-menu  a  { color: #FFFFFF; font-size:11;  font-variant: small-caps; text-transform: uppercase; 
               font-family: Times New Roman; font-weight: bold; text-align: center; padding:3px}
.header-menu  a:hover    { color: #FFFF00; font-size:11;  width: 100%; text-align: center; padding:3px;                background-color: #FF0000; background-image: url(../images/do-hover.png); background-repeat: repeat-x; background-position: left center }



.tieude-title { border-style:inset; border-width:1px; font-family: Arial;  font-variant: small-caps; font-size: 11pt; 
               color: #FF0000; text-transform: capitalize; vertical-align: 
               middle; font-weight: bold; text-align: left; 
               background-color: #EBEBEB; padding-left:3px; padding-right:3px; padding-top:2px; padding-bottom:2px }
.tieudetintuc { }
.mauxanhdam  { color: #0066FF; font-size: 8pt; font-variant: small-caps; text-transform: uppercase ; font-weight: bold   }
.hinhsanpham { 	height: auto; width: auto; text-align: left; float: left; border: 2px ridge #FFFF00 }
.hinhsanpham-chitiet { padding:2px; background-color: #999999;  border: 2px ridge  #CCCCCC }
.giasanpham  { font-family: Arial; color: #FF6600; font-size: 9pt; font-weight: bold }
h5           { text-align: left;  font-variant: small-caps; text-transform: uppercase; color: #FF6600; font-family: Arial; font-weight: bold}
h4           {  text-align: left; width:99%;  font-variant: small-caps; text-transform: uppercase; color: #FF6600;  font-family: Times New Roman; font-weight: bold; text-align: left; border: 1px solid #EBEBEB; padding: 2px; background-color: #FFFFCC }
.tintuc		{ font-family: Arial,  Times New Roman }
.tintuc a	{  color: #0066FF; text-decoration:none }
.tintuc a:hover	{  color: #FF0000}
.tintuc .tieude	{  font-family: Times New Roman; color: #FF6600; text-transform: uppercase; font-variant: 
               small-caps; font-size: 12pt; font-weight: bold; text-align: 
               left; padding-left: 4px}
.tintuc .h5		{  font-weight: bold}
.tintuc .chitiet		{ font-size:13px; font-family: Times New Roman; color:#333333 }
.tintuc .ngay	{  font-size: 8pt; font-family: Arial; color: #808080}
.tintuc .hinh img	{  border: 1px solid #C2C1C1; padding: 2px}
.tintuc .noidung	{  font-size: 11pt; font-family: Times New Roman; text-transform: capitalize; 
               text-align: justify; padding-left: 3px; padding-right: 3px}
.tintuc .xemchitiet	a {  text-align: right; font-family: Arial; font-size: 10pt; color: #008000; 
               width: 100px; border: 3px double #EBEBEB; padding-left: 3px;  padding-right: 3px; padding-top: 1px; padding-bottom: 1px}
.tintuc .cungloai	{  }
.tintuc .cungloai a:hover		{  color: #FF0000; text-decoration: underline; font-family: Times New Roman; 
               font-size: 10pt}
.tintuc .cungloai a		{  font-family: Times New Roman; color: #008000; font-size: 10pt}
 
.tintuc .icon	a {  text-align: center;  height: auto; width:auto;  text-align: center; border: 3px double #C0C0C0; padding-left: 1px; 
               padding-right: 1px}











a {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-decoration:none;		
}
a: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-decoration:none;
}
table {
	background-color: #FFFFFF;
}
td_over:hover {
	 background:#EE0000;
}

img {
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}
a: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#FF0000;	
}
#menuleft: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#FFFF00;	
}
.add_buton { background:#CCFF99; font-size:12px; color:#FF0000; width:60; height:18px;}

.price {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#FF6600;
	font-size: 11px;	
	font-weight: bold;
}
.oldprice {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#777777;
	font-size: 9px;
	text-decoration: line-through;
}
.p_name {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#000000;		
	font-weight: bold;
}

.menu {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#EEEEEE;
	font-size: 12px;
	text-decoration:underline;
	font-weight: bold;
}
.cat_menu {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#CCFF33;
	font-size: 13px;	
	font-weight: bold;
}
.subcat_menu {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	font-size: 12px;
	font-weight: ;
}
.product_title {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#000000;
	font-size: 14px;	
	font-weight: bold; 	text-align:left;
}
.n_title {
	font-weight: bold;
	background-position: left;
}
input, select, textarea{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#333333;
	font-size: 11px;
}
.inputqty {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#BBBBBB
	font-size: 14px;
}
.submit{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#333333;
	font-size: 11px;
	font-weight:bold;
	padding:1px;
	margin-bottom:-1px;
}
.textarea{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#333333;
	font-size: 11px;
}
span#red {
	color:red;
}
span#green {
	color:green;
}
span#blue {
	color:blue;
}
span#orange {
	color:orange;
}
span#gray {
	color:#999999;
}
p {
	margin:5px;
}
form {
margin:0px;
}
h3 {
margin:5px;
font-size:15px;
}
h5 {
margin:5px;
font-size:11px;
}

.left_spnb {
	float:left;
	background:url(../images/nb_left.jpg) no-repeat;	
	height:18px; 
	width:27px
	}
.right_spnb {
	float:left;background:url(../images/nb_right.jpg) no-repeat;
	height:18px;
	width:18px;
	}
.center_spnb {
float:left;background:url(../images/nb_center.jpg) repeat-x; 
height:18px; color:#FFFFFF; 
font-family:Tahoma;
font-size:12px; 
font-weight:bold; 
width:140px; padding-top:2px;
}
.boxsp{ border:1px solid #666; text-align:center; background-color:#fff; }

}
.spbc{border:1px solid #607697; padding-top:5px; padding-left:5px; padding-right:5px; padding-bottom:5px;}
.spbc0{border:1px solid #607697; padding-bottom:5px;}


.font_menu_TA2 { color: #FFFFFF; text-transform: uppercase; font-family: Tahoma; font-size: 
               10pt; font-weight: bold; text-align: left; padding-left: 2px; 
               background-color: #FF9933; background-image: 
               url('../images/menutop.jpg'); height:20; vertical-align:middle }

#menutopnen  { background-image: url(../images/menutopnen.png)}

.font_menu_TA232{
background:url(../images/bg_menu2.gif); height:20px; font-family:Tahoma; font-size:11px; font-weight:bold; color:#FFFFFF; padding-top:5px; padding-left:3px; text-transform:uppercase;
}
.font_menu_TA{
background:url(../images/bg_menu.gif); height:22px; font-family:Tahoma; font-size:11px; font-weight:bold; color:#FFFFFF; padding-top:5px; padding-left:3px; text-transform:uppercase;
}
 

.sub_font_menu_TA{
	height: 18px;
	font-family:Tahoma;
	font-size:11px;
	color:#FFFFFF;
	background-color: #003399;
padding-left:3px; background-image:url(../images/nenmunu.jpg); height:18px; font-family:Tahoma; font-size:12px; color:#FFFFFF; 
padding-top:2px; padding-left:3px; text-align:left; padding-bottom:0px }

#maudo:hover      { color: #FFFF00;  background-image:url('../images/do-hover.png'); height:18px; padding-bottom:0px; padding-top:2px}

#mauvang:hover      { color: #FFFF00;  background-image:url('../images/do-hover.png')}

.light {background:#EEEEEE;}
.unlight { background:#DDDDDD;}
.news_title {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#000000;
	font-weight: bold;
	text-align: left;
	text-align:left;
}
.news_title_2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color:#0000EE;
	font-size:16px;
	font-weight: bold;
	background-position: 2px 2px;
	page-break-before: left;
	page-break-after: left; text-align: left;
}
.div_news_images{ float:left; padding-right:5px;}
.div_news_des{
	text-align:justify;
	background-position: 2px 2px;
}
.div_news_des_b{ text-align:justify; color:#777777; font-weight: bold;}
.news_date{
	font-size:95%;
	font-style:italic;
	color:#999999;
	text-align: left;
}
.newsdetail{font-size:100%; text-align:justify; padding:5px 3px 5px 2px; color:#333;}
.note{ float:right; font-style:italic; color:#AAAAAA; font-weight: bold;}
.keywords{ text-align:justify;}
.lightwords{ background:#FFFF33; }
.font_title1 A:hover{
text-decoration:underline;
color:#4F6086
}
.clear{ clear:both;}
.space{ padding-top:5px;}

		#adv {
	height: auto;
	width: 175px; 	position: static; 	clip: rect(auto,auto,auto,auto);
	z-index: 0; 	top: 0px; 	bottom: 0px; 	left: 0px;
	background: #FF33CC repeat scroll center center;
	padding: 0px; 	margin: 0px; 	border-top: 0px solid #FFCCFF;
	border-right: 0px solid #CCCCCC; 	border-bottom: 0px solid #FF00FF;
	border-left: 0px solid #CCFFFF;
	}
	/*---------
		#adv2 {
	height: 240px;
	width: 444px; 	position: static; 	clip: rect(auto,auto,auto,auto);
	z-index: 0; 	top: 0px; 	bottom: 0px; 	left: 0px;
	background: #FF33CC repeat scroll center center;
	padding: 0px; 	margin: 0px; 	border-top: 0px solid #FFCCFF;
	border-right: 0px solid #CCCCCC; 	border-bottom: 0px solid #FF00FF;
	border-left: 0px solid #CCFFFF;
	}
	-----Su dung 1 hinh va co san phan uu chuon------*/
	 
		#adv2 {
	height: 200px;
	width: 310px; 	position: static; 	clip: rect(auto,auto,auto,auto);
	z-index: 0; 	top: 0px; 	bottom: 0px; 	left: 0px;
	background: #FF33CC repeat scroll center center;
	padding: 0px; 	margin: 0px; 	border-top: 0px solid #FFCCFF;
	border-right: 0px solid #CCCCCC; 	border-bottom: 0px solid #FF00FF;
	border-left: 0px solid #CCFFFF;
	}
	 
	
#tinmoichay {
	list-style-position: inside;
	list-style-type: circle;
	width: auto;
	float: left;
	text-align: center;
	vertical-align: middle;
	font-size: 12px;
	margin: auto;
	 
}
#tinmoichaynoidung {
	list-style-position: inside;
	list-style-type: circle;
	width:594px;
	float: left;
	text-align: justify;
	vertical-align: middle;
	border: 0px solid #FFFFFF;
}
#clear{
	clear: both;
	float: none;
}

#advtop1 {
	list-style-position: inside;
	list-style-type: circle;
	border: 1px solid #CCCCCC;
	width: 445px;
	margin-right: 1px;
	float: left;
	text-align: center;
	vertical-align: top;
}

#advtop2 {
	list-style-position: inside;
	list-style-type: circle;
	border: 0px solid #CCCCCC;
	width: 200px;
	margin-right: 1px;
	float: left;
	text-align: left;
	vertical-align: top;
	font-size: 11px;
	font-family: "Times New Roman";
	height: auto;
	background-color: #FFFFCC;
}
	#adv3 {
	height: 80px;
	width: auto; 	position: static; 	clip: rect(auto,auto,auto,auto);
	z-index: 0; 	top: 0px; 	bottom: 0px; 	left: 0px;
	background: #FF33CC repeat scroll center center;
	padding: 0px; 	margin: 0px; 	border-top: 0px solid #FFCCFF;
	border-right: 0px solid #CCCCCC; 	border-bottom: 0px solid #FF00FF;
	border-left: 0px solid #CCFFFF;
	}
	
#adv4 {
	height: auto;	width:170px; border: 1px solid #000080;; background-color:#CCFF33; padding-left:1px; padding-right:1px; padding-top:2px; padding-bottom:2px
	}


	#hinhtintuc {
	height: 80px;
	width: auto; 	position: static; 	clip: rect(auto,auto,auto,auto);
	z-index: 0; 	top: 0px; 	bottom: 0px; 	left: 0px;
	background: #FF33CC repeat scroll center center;
	padding: 0px; 	margin: 0px; 	border-top: 0px solid #FFCCFF;
	border-right: 0px solid #CCCCCC; 	border-bottom: 0px solid #FF00FF;
	border-left: 0px solid #CCFFFF;
}
	#adv5 {
	height: 140px;
	width: 790px; 	position: static; 	clip: rect(auto,auto,auto,auto);
	z-index: 0; 	top: 0px; 	bottom: 0px; 	left: 0px;
	background: #FF33CC repeat scroll center center;
	padding: 0px; 	margin: 0px; 	border-top: 0px solid #FFCCFF;
	border-right: 0px solid #CCCCCC; 	border-bottom: 0px solid #FF00FF;
	border-left: 0px solid #CCFFFF;
}
	#adv6 {
	height:auto;
	width: 620px; 	position: static; 	clip: rect(auto,auto,auto,auto);
	z-index: 0; 	top: 0px; 	bottom: 0px; 	left: 0px;
	background: #FF33CC repeat scroll center center;
	padding: 0px; 	margin: 0px; 	border-top: 0px solid #FFCCFF;
	border-right: 0px solid #CCCCCC; 	border-bottom: 0px solid #FF00FF;
	border-left: 0px solid #CCFFFF;
}
		#moidoigia {
	height: auto;
	width: 150px; 	position: static; 	clip: rect(auto,auto,auto,auto);
	z-index: 0; 	top: 0px; 	bottom: 0px; 	left: 0px;
	background: #FF33CC repeat scroll center center;
	padding: 0px; 	margin: 0px; 	border-top: 0px solid #FFCCFF;
	border-right: 0px solid #CCCCCC; 	border-bottom: 0px solid #FF00FF;
	border-left: 0px solid #CCFFFF;
	}
#bannertop { border-right:1px solid #C0C0C0; border-top:0px solid #C0C0C0; padding:0; width: 780px; height: 140; text-align: center; vertical-align:top; border-left-width:0px; border-bottom-width:0px; background-color:#EBEBEB; background-image:url(../images/banner.jpg)}

#logo    { width: 220; height: 130; text-align: center; background-image: url(../images/logo.jpg)}

#menutintuc { border-right:1px solid #C0C0C0; border-top:1px solid #C0C0C0; padding:0; width: auto; height: auto; text-align: center; vertical-align:top; border-left-width:2px; border-bottom-width:2px; background-color:#EBEBEB; background-image:url(../images/menutintuc.gif)}

.noidungtimkiem         { font-size: 10pt; font-family: Times New Roman; color: #333333; 
               vertical-align: middle; text-align: justify }
.chuhoa      { text-transform: uppercase; color: #0000FF; font-weight: bold }
#fring {
	text-align: right;
	clear: right;
	page-break-before: right;
	page-break-after: right;
}
